6-year-old Roy Orbison 3 , stage debut with Joe Walsh & Dave Grohl on "Rocky Mountain Way"
Joe Walsh invited his 6-year-old godson Roy Orbison 3 on stage for the finale of his sixth annual VetsAid charity concert at “Ohio's Nationwide Arena," Columbus, Ohio, November 13th, 2022. Roy 3 played Walsh’s “Rocky Mountain Way” with his godfather on vocals and lead guitar, Dave Grohl on drums, Nathan East on bass, and “The Breeders” as backup singers. This video features backstage footage, footage from rehearsal and soundcheck and the actual performance from beginning to end, with Roy 3 walking out on stage after 3 minutes.
